What It Is

Galaxypay is a cryptocurrency payment processing service for merchants, positioned around the slogan “Accept & Send Crypto across the globe.” According to its website, it can be used to accept crypto payments, deposits, and donations online. It also supports retail stores or restaurants in accepting Bitcoin via smartphone/tablet, and can send Bitcoin invoices.

Core Capabilities

In terms of payment methods, Galaxypay claims to support 15 cryptocurrencies and accept 90+ crypto wallets, covering about 70% of the total global crypto market capitalization. For geographic reach, its service is available in 229 countries and regions, while fiat bank settlement is supported in 38 countries. For settlement, merchants can choose to receive funds in fiat, cryptocurrency, or a mix of both, with support for bank deposits in currencies such as USD, EUR, and GBP. The page emphasizes “zero price volatility or risk” through direct settlement to a bank account, but does not explain the specific hedging or conversion mechanism.

Pricing and Fees

The pricing information is relatively clear: a 1% transaction commission, no monthly minimum, no setup cost, and free registration. For small and medium-sized merchants, this low-barrier fixed pricing model is fairly friendly. However, the main text does not clarify whether there are additional costs such as withdrawal fees, FX/conversion spreads, network miner fees, or cross-border bank settlement fees, so the true all-in cost still needs further verification.

Compliance, Risk Control, and Integration

Its risk-control messaging mainly centers on “Risk-free transactions,” with an emphasis that fiat settlement can reduce exposure to crypto price volatility. However, the page does not disclose licensing, KYC/AML procedures, sanctions screening, transaction monitoring, fraud prevention, or dispute-handling mechanisms. On the API and integration side, there is also no visible developer documentation, SDKs, plugins, or e-commerce platform compatibility information. The only confirmed use cases are online payments, mobile in-person payments, and invoicing.

Pros, Cons, and Best Fit

Its strengths are broad country coverage, support for a wide range of wallets, a simple fee structure, and flexible settlement in fiat and/or cryptocurrency. The main weakness is limited transparency on key details, especially regulatory credentials, settlement timelines, technical integration, and the full fee schedule. It is better suited to cross-border e-commerce businesses, digital service providers, donation projects, and small offline merchants that want a low-barrier way to test crypto acceptance. For merchants in heavily regulated industries or those processing large transaction volumes, licensing and risk-control capabilities should be verified first.
